FPA Region V upskills farmer-entrepreneurs on safe handling of pesticides

Written by : Rosie T. Malazar |  Published: 24 May 2023

 

 

 

PILI, CAMARINES SUR | May 23, 2023 – To protect the public from the inherent risks of pesticides and address concerns in food safety, the FPA Bicol Region collaborated with the Department of Agriculture – Regional Field Office V (DA-RFO5) to conduct the “Pesticide Training: Pesticide Safe Handling, to Ensure Food Safety and Public Health Protection” at Sta. Catalina Hall, FOD Bldg., DA-RFO5 Cmpd., San Agustin, Pili, Camarines Sur on May 16, 2023.

 

Led by FPA Regional Officer (RO) Gabriel Atole, the team equipped the participants with general information on pesticides and its label, as well as safe handling, application, storage, and disposal.

 

In addition, Ms. Monalisa Monay, R.N., a nurse toxicologist of the Bicol Medical Center – Poison Control Center (BMC-PCC), discussed the guidance and prevention of pesticide poisoning. She reminded the farmers to take precautions in handling the products and be responsible for themselves and their laborers to ensure occupational safety on their farms.

 

RO Atole extended his gratitude to the BMC-PCC, DA-RFO5, and participants for successfully conducting the training.

 

He encouraged them to practice what they had learned during the training and strengthened the partnership with different stakeholders for pesticide safe and judicious use.

 

A total of 48 farmers attended the said activity. ###
